Heavy Equipment Operator, Bridge Construction
A.M. Cohron & Son
JOB SUMMARY
Operate heavy equipment, usually on a bridge construction jobsite. Travel from jobsite to jobsite in Iowa, Nebraska, Kansas, Oklahoma, Arkansas or Missouri. This job is located in Red Oak, IA. Work Monday to Friday, and some weekends, usually 40-50 hours. Overnight stays may be required at the company's expense.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
- Attend work as scheduled
- Get along with others
- Follow company handbooks and other instructions
- Use and care for tools, equipment and materials
- Read and understand equipment manuals
ADDITIONA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Inspect and maintain equipment to prevent malfunctions or damage
- Operate the equipment skillfully and safely in conformance with OSHA regulations
- Cut, sidehill cut, ditch dig, slot doze, backfill, clear and grub and finish
- Demolish, clear and level jobsites of old bridges, buildings, trees, shrubs, earth, rocks, concrete, etc.
- Use hydraulic hoses, wedge-pin hitches and cable-operated blades
- Maneuver the machine by using levers and pedals to raise and lower or tilt the attachment
- Lower terrain by following grade stakes or hand signals
- Detect and adjust defects in equipment and perform minor repairs using grease gun, oil can and hand tools
- Work safely by using a bi-directional signal, headache rack/brush guard, seat belt and rollover protection
- Read and interpret Safety Data Sheets and container labels
- Identify and communicate safety concerns to management in a timely manner
- Operate other equipment and perform other duties as assigned
Education, Experience & Certification
- High School graduate or G.E.D. preferred
- Valid drivers license
- Experience operating construction equipment
Physical
- Normal range of vision and hearing (with correction)
- Dexterous use of hands and feet
- Climb in and out of equipment unassisted
- Effectively work at heights
- Walk, stand, climb, bend, kneel, reach, lift and balance
- Lift up to 50 pounds on a regular basis
- Work safely in adverse weather conditions including wind, rain, snow, ice, mud, heat, etc.
